> I checked out the rspec-dev repository on a MBP (Leopard) and tried to
> run the pre_commit task after going through the setup/configuration
> steps on http://wiki.github.com/dchelimsky/rspec/contribute.
>
> I'm getting DRB errors related to script/spec_server when running
> specs: Address already in use - bind(2) (Errno::EADDRINUSE). Running
> lsof -i tcp:8989 shows:
>
> ruby 9674 douglas 5u IPv4 0x6538a68 0t0 TCP
> localhost:sunwebadmins (LISTEN)
>
> I've tried changing the DRB port to 20111 and running rake pre_commit
> again but the same problem comes up. Is this something people have
> come across before?
I actually just noticed it a couple of days ago. I was able to resolve
it by building and installing the rspec gem, so there is an apparent
dependency on that being present. We're going to be re-vamping (read
*simplifying*) the whole rspec-dev setup in the next month or so, so
I'm not going to try to fix this right now, but installing the gem
should solve it for you.
